Digital therapeutics (DTx) are evidence-based interventions delivered via software to prevent, manage, or treat health conditions. According to recent industry reports, the global digital therapeutics market was valued at over $4.15 billion in 2022 and projects a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 27.7% over the next five years. This rapid expansion underscores their potential to complement traditional psychiatric treatments, especially in accessible, remote, and scalable formats.
